GCSE Chemistry 9-1 Ionic and Simple Molecular Covalent Bonding Practice Questions
hf583hf583

GCSE Chemistry 9-1 Ionic and Simple Molecular Covalent Bonding Practice Questions

(1)
This resource contains 14 practice questions. Four questions are based on interpreting dot-and-cross diagrams for ionic compounds and focuses on students explaining, in terms of electrons, how atoms react. The other ten questions are additional examples of simple covalent molecules that students could be asked to apply their knowledge of completing dot-and-cross diagrams to, for example hydrogen sulphide, iodine, silicon tetrahydride, ethane etc. These resources are provided in label format with 4 identical questions per sheet. These can be printed simply on A4 paper or can alternatively be printed on 4 per sheet labels and used as a diagnostic question for homework or to reinforce key concepts before the final exam.

GCSE Elements, mixtures and compounds worksheets
hf583hf583

GCSE Elements, mixtures and compounds worksheets

(1)
Worksheets covering the basics of elements, compounds and mixtures for the new AQA GCSE Chemistry/Trilogy course. Could also be used for key stage 3 Science. This resources consists of 4 worksheets on one file: 1) Elements or compounds - identifying elements and compounds from symbols/formulae, 2) Elements, compounds and mixtures - matching statements (or could use as a card sort), 3) Identifying elements, compounds and mixtures from particle pictures and 4) Metal, non-metal or can't tell? - identifying metals and non-metals from properties given. Answers for each sheet included.
